UAS 1022
Aviation Weather
North Arkansas College · Fall 2026
1 section
Catalog description
This course explores weather phenomena and atmospheric conditions that affect unmanned aerial systems (UAS) operations. Students will learn to interpret aviation weather reports, forecasts, and meteorological charts to assess flight risks and plan safe, compliant operations. Topics include air pressure systems, wind patterns, precipitation, and extreme weather that impact drone performance. Through case studies and hands-on analysis, students will develop the skills to evaluate environmental conditions, mitigate risks, and adjust flight plans for safe and efficient UAS operations. Lecture 2 hours per week.
